简单来说,mysql_query函数本身就已经被废弃了,从PHP 7.0开始就彻底移除了。
原因是&i获取的是interface{}变量本身的地址,而不是interface{}内部存储的具体值的地址。
std::string用.length()或.size(),C风格字符串用strlen()。
常见陷阱与建议 不要混淆变量递增和指针移动。
它不是用来设置默认选中值的。
如果维度大小已知,可以考虑使用数组代替切片,或者预先分配足够的内存。
如果您系统中有多个PHP版本,最好明确安装对应版本的php-dev包。
本文旨在解决在使用Python发送邮件时,附件文件名中包含空格导致的问题。
装饰器模式通过组合扩展对象功能,避免类爆炸。
原始代码结构: 立即学习“Python免费学习笔记(深入)”;from kivy.uix.button import Button as KivyButton from kivy.properties import ObjectProperty class Cell(): def onClick(self): print("Clicked from Cell") def getWidget(self, stringValue): btn = CustomButton() # 1. 创建一个CustomButton实例 btn.addCell(self) # 2. 将自身(Cell对象)传递给这个实例,并绑定事件 return KivyButton(text=stringValue) # 3. **错误:这里创建并返回了一个全新的KivyButton实例** class CustomButton(KivyButton): cell = ObjectProperty(None) # 存储关联的Cell对象 def addCell(self, cell_obj): self.cell = cell_obj self.bind(on_press=self.cell.onClick) # 绑定on_press事件到Cell的onClick方法在这段代码中,Cell.getWidget方法存在一个关键的逻辑错误。
即radial_distances <= Rmax ** 2。
使用Eloquent操作数据库 Laravel的Eloquent ORM让数据库操作变得简单。
基本上就这些常用方法。
constexpr用于声明编译时常量或函数,要求值在编译期确定,适用于数组大小、模板参数等场景;其变量需用常量表达式初始化,如constexpr int size = 10;不能使用运行时变量初始化,如constexpr int y = x(x为变量)错误;constexpr函数在传入常量表达式时可编译期求值,C++14起支持复杂语句;与const区别在于const允许运行时初始化,而constexpr必须编译期确定;所有constexpr变量都是const,但反之不成立;常见应用包括定义数组大小和模板参数,如Buffer<square(4)> buf。
应用条件判断: 在循环体内部,对当前子数组的特定键(例如'b')的值进行条件检查(例如是否等于'123')。
<int:pk> 是一个路径转换器,它告诉Django捕获URL中这部分内容作为一个整数,并将其作为名为 pk 的参数传递给 user_info 视图函数。
这对于创建有效期受限或只能访问一次的链接非常有用,例如邮件验证链接、密码重置链接或一次性下载链接。
PHP 实时输出主要用于处理大量数据或长时间运行的任务时,防止脚本占用过多内存导致崩溃。
示例代码: #include <sstream> #include <string> #include <iostream> int main() { std::string hex_str = "1A"; std::stringstream ss; int decimal; ss << std::hex << hex_str; ss >> decimal; std::cout << "十进制值为:" << decimal << std::endl; return 0; } 这种方式适合在需要混合处理多种进制时使用。
教程将详细介绍如何通过在密码更新后立即重新认证用户并重新生成会话,从而有效保持用户登录状态,确保流畅的用户体验。
本文链接:http://www.andazg.com/37354_76926.html